As per AC Signature Suite page - July 2, 2021
* Air Canada Signature Class customers travelling on an Air Canada-operated flight (to Europe, Asia and South America) originally booked and ticketed in the following booking classes will be eligible for access to the Air Canada Signature Suite: J, C, D, Z, P. Only Aeroplan flight rewards booked as a Business Class Flexible Reward or a First Class Flexible Reward in J, C, D, Z, P, I booking classes are eligible for access. All bookings in R class (including, but not limited to, eUpgrades, Last-Minute Upgrades, and AC Bid Upgrades), Aeroplan flight rewards booked as a Business Class Lowest Reward or a First Class Lowest Reward, Star Alliance Upgrade Awards, Business Class flight rewards booked and ticketed by partner airlines, and I (including Star Alliance Upgrade Awards), as well as bookings made during irregular operations where the customer was not originally booked and confirmed in one of the eligible booking classes, will be excluded. Eligible customers may not invite guests. Access to the Air Canada Signature Suite is not available to customers travelling on promotional tickets or employees.

Visited May 24 at noon, flew out on AC1. Pardon the low quality mobile phone images.
I haven't flown AC in many years as I've thrown all my transpacific business to CX and BR (way better in all regards IMO) however was intrigued by AC's new premium push (plus amazing P fare ) to try it out again.
Signature Suite is a nice looking lounge (hate the name), rather dark inside. The only apron view is in the hallway to the washrooms. As mentioned earlier - the main function of this lounge appears to serve as a "Dining Room" for Signature Class Pax, there is minimal seating for work or lounging, also no showers or business centre. Service staff is eager and friendly. Not AC employees?
That said the food is good, about as close to "restaurant" quality that Air Canada will get, therefore a HUGE step up from the terrible food served onboard AC transpacific flights (the Hawksworth affiliation is putting "lipstick on a pig" IMHO). The vegan chocolate cake was my favourite item followed by the soup, the falafel meh.
I took some photos of the food and current menu.
At noon with HND, ICN and PEK flights, the lounge was hopping, not full but busy, hard to take photos but enough seats. I can see this being packed in early evening therefore I 100% agree that admission should be limited to fare paying Business Class customers, otherwise seating and service time is compromised, not to mention the peace and quiet. Lounge at noon was all business travellers and no families or kids. Love that
NOTES on the Inflight Experience: I do not find the "Signature Class" service much of an upgrade, garlic bread (woo hoo!) and a thin, useless mattress pad are negligible upgrades I think. The hard product is still good, not great, the person who designed that seat table that doesn't store away, therefore in the way of ones knees, should be shot.
Seat 7A is my favourite seat on the 77W. It appears to be the most private seat on the aircraft, and the quietest (the F/A's all gather to gossip in the forward galley, the door 2 galley was totally empty and quiet the entire flight, minus service times. Also seems that all the pax in the forward cabin J always used forward lavatory, the 2 Door 2 lavs were mostly unused and clean all flight long. Only minus of 7A is 1 window.
